用雨蛙肽(胆囊收缩素类似物)对舞蹈症进行急性缓解及长期改善

Acute reduction and long-term improvement of chorea with ceruletide (cholecystokinin analogue).

作者信息

Hashimoto T, Yanagisawa N

机构信息

Department of Medicine (Neurology), Shinshu University School of Medicine, Matsumoto, Japan.

出版信息

J Neurol Sci. 1990 Dec;100(1-2):178-85. doi: 10.1016/0022-510x(90)90031-h.

DOI:10.1016/0022-510x(90)90031-h
PMID:1708407
Abstract

We studied the effects of ceruletide, a cholecystokinin analogue, on choreic involuntary movement in several neurological diseases by clinical scoring and electromyography in 11 patients. Ceruletide brought about a brief reduction of choreic movement reaching its maximum within 60 min and another long-lasting improvement over several weeks by single administration. The levels of homovanillic acid in cerebrospinal fluid before treatment were significantly higher in cases with long-lasting improvement than those in cases without improvement. We suggest that ceruletide may reduce choreic movement for a long period through effects on the central dopamine system and speculate that such a long-term effect may be accounted for by the change in transmission after the second messengers in neurons.
